Man Utd make wonderkid JJ Gabriel debut decision ahead of FA Cup clash

https://www.dailystar.co.uk/sport/football/jj-gabriel-manchester-united-fletcher-36533386https://www.goal.com/en-gb/lists/why-kid-messi-jj-gabriel-not-man-utd-squad-fa-cup-15-year-old-wonderkid-eligible-debut-darren-fletcher/blt36dbaf54e401d469
Dailystar.co.uk and 1 more
  • Darren Fletcher says JJ Gabriel will not feature in United's FA Cup clash against Brighton this weekend, keeping him out of the first-team squad for now.
  • Gabriel remains eligible for the FA Cup despite being 15, as Premier League rules restrict him there but FA Cup rules allow his inclusion.
  • Fletcher describes Gabriel as a fantastic talent with strong work ethic and a genuine love for football, training, and expressing himself on the pitch.
  • Gabriel has already made history as United's youngest-ever FA Youth Cup representative, signaling high long-term potential.
  • The youth standout netted the decisive goal in a 1-0 Youth Cup win over Peterborough, highlighting his clutch impact at youth level.
  • Observers note a bright future for Gabriel, with optimism about his long-term development at United as he gains more experience.
  • Fletcher emphasizes that Gabriel's learning path remains with the U18s for now, focusing on daily improvement and development.
  • Man United notes Gabriel's exposure to first-team training and has previously welcomed him to the directors' box, underscoring his close ties to the senior setup.
  • Gabriel's prolific youth form includes 11 goals in 14 U18 appearances this season, reinforcing the talent track alongside his international attention.
  • The piece highlights Gabriel as United's youngest FA Youth Cup participant, reinforcing a record-breaking start to his youth career.

Shea Lacey loses his head! Man Utd wonderkid shown first career red card after petulant outburst in FA Cup defeat to Brighton | Goal.com UK

https://www.goal.com/en-gb/lists/shea-lacey-loses-head-man-utd-wonderkid-first-career-red-card-petulant-outburst-fa-cup-brighton/blt4f2c5f8d25d50c81https://metro.co.uk/2026/01/11/darren-fletcher-makes-shea-lacey-claim-red-card-man-utd-fa-cup-defeat-26227403/https://www.dailystar.co.uk/sport/football/manchester-united-darren-fletcher-brighton-36534646
Goal.com and 3 more
  • Brighton sealed the win with Danny Welbeck scoring after Brajan Gruda had earlier given United a tough task to overturn the deficit at Old Trafford.
  • Lacey was sent off with a second yellow for dissent after a late foul, capping a challenging night that dampened United's resurgence.
  • Fletcher confronted referee Simon Hooper at full-time, signaling ongoing disputes over officiating after United's FA Cup exit.

Luke Shaw update after missing Man Utd's FA Cup defeat

  • Luke Shaw was absent from Manchester United's FA Cup third-round defeat to Brighton.
  • Darren Fletcher said the absence was not injury-related but a rest decision due to a busy schedule.
  • Shaw’s absence was described as a rest decision rather than an injury excuse.
  • Fletcher indicated Luke Shaw should be available for the next Manchester derby if fitness allows.
  • The FA Cup exit came after goals from Brajan Gruda and Danny Welbeck put Brighton in control.
  • Benjamin Sesko pulled a late goal for United in the loss to Brighton.
